The defending champions, Boston Celtics, are coming off a 4-1 series win against the Orlando Magic in the Eastern Conference First Round playoff series. The Celtics won Game 5, 120-89. The Celtics were led by Jayson Tatum's 35 points and 10 rebounds, securing a double-double, and he also had 8 assists.
Jaylen Brown also capped off the series with a 23-point, 6-rebound game. Kristaps Porzingis played 21 minutes, scoring 9 points, while Al Horford played the most minutes off the bench, contributing 9 points, 6 rebounds, and 4 assists. The Celtics held Orlando to under 100 points in each of the last three games.
They have a tougher matchup against the New York Knicks in the Semifinal Round. The Celtics remained undefeated against the Knicks in the regular season, going 4-0. Jayson Tatum is averaging 33.5 points per game against the Knicks this season; he is the primary playmaker and contributes on both ends of the floor.
Kristaps Porzingis, if healthy, will have a bigger role to play in protecting the rim and not allowing Karl-Anthony Towns to dominate in the paint. Towns has had a couple of 23-plus point games against the Celtics this season, and they will be wary of the offensive threat that he possesses.
In the last five games, the Celtics are averaging 106.4 points per game on offense, and on defense, they have allowed 93.6 points per game. The Celtics have been a dominant team in three-point shooting, averaging 11.8 three-pointers made per game in their last five games.
The New York Knicks pulled off a last-minute win over the Detroit Pistons to cap off the series 4-2. A dagger three-pointer from Jalen Brunson with 5.1 seconds left on the game clock ensured the Knicks won the series. Brunson dropped 40 points and had a 7-assist game to close out the series as the Knicks won 113-116. Mikal Bridges and OG Anunoby scored 25 and 22 points, respectively.
Karl-Anthony Towns recorded a 10-point, 15-rebound double-double, and Josh Hart also had a 13-point, 10-rebound double-double. The Knicks now head to Boston, facing arguably the hardest and toughest team they have encountered in the Eastern Conference this season. In the regular season, the Celtics swept the Knicks.
The Knicks will have to be spot-on with their perimeter defense and not allow the Celtics open looks from beyond the arc. When the Celtics hit under 10 three-pointers per game, they lost two games against the Magic. So, defense is crucial, and the Celtics did struggle when the Magic targeted the paint and scored from mid-range. Therefore, the Knicks might look to employ the same strategy, aiming to draw fouls and score from the interior.
Karl-Anthony Towns will have a significant workload on the offensive end, and the big man has put up good numbers against the Celtics this season, averaging 19.75 points and 12 rebounds per game. He will look to have a strong performance against the Celtics and also be key in grabbing offensive and defensive rebounds.
The Knicks on offense are averaging 108 points per game in their last six games and have allowed 106 points per game defensively. They have averaged 11 three-pointers made per game in their last six and have scored more two-pointers.

The Boston Celtics host the New York Knicks in Game 1 of the Eastern Conference Semifinal Round at TD Garden in Boston. The Celtics are undefeated against the Knicks this season, having swept them 4-0. At home, the Celtics hold a 7-game winning streak, while the Knicks are also on a four-game winning streak in away games.
In the last four games between the Celtics and the Knicks, the average total match points per game is 233.8. The Celtics have averaged 125 points per game and restricted the Knicks to 108.8 points per game. The Celtics are averaging a staggering 21 three-pointers made per game against the Knicks this season, while the Knicks are better at scoring from mid-range, averaging 30.75 two-pointers made per game.
